The income summary account is a temporary account used to store income statement account balances, revenue and expense accounts, during the closing entry step of the accounting cycle. Income summary account is a temporary account used in the closing stage of the accounting cycle to compile all income and expense balances and determine net income or net loss for the period. The Income Summary account is only used during the year-end closing process -- it facilitates the transfer of balances away from the temporary accounts and into the permanent accounts.
